How far is Diamond Creek from Melbourne's Central Business District?

Diamond Creek is located about 23 km north‑east of Melbourne's CBD.

What public transport options are nearby?

The Diamond Creek railway station, on the Hurstbridge line, is roughly 1.4 km away, offering train services to the city.

Can you share a brief history of Diamond Creek?

Gold was first discovered in Diamond Creek in 1863, leading to the opening of the Diamond Creek mine, and the suburb later developed historic sites such as Ellis Cottage and St John’s Anglican church.
